Fan’s custom-made Shohei Ohtani Mets jersey includes egregious error

What are the chances we’ll see the Mets land two-way superstar Shohei Ohtani next winter? It’s bound to be a bidding war, with New York and the Los Angeles Dodgers being two of the expected favorites.

But remember how Ohtani wanted nothing to do with the East Coast before signing with the Angels in December 2017? That may not be as much of a roadblock anymore, according to a recent report from Jon Heyman of the New York Post.

While it seems like Mets owner Steve Cohen very much wants to make a run at Ohtani, it’s far from a certainty that the Amazins would actually land him in free agency.
